Southern California Institute Of Technology

The Southern California Institute of Technology, also known as SCIT, is located in Anaheim, California. After the National Education Center’s Institute of Technology in Anaheim closed down, the institute’s administrator and other instructors took the initiative to establish SCIT, which occurred in 1987. SCIT offers certificates and associate’s and bachelor’s degree in areas like networking specialization, electrical engineering, business management and accounting, among others.

The Southern California Institute of Technology is home to several international students. The institution provides financial aid to help students fulfill their education in the form of federal grants, private loans and work study programs. The Student Services Office at SCIT provides academic counseling and tutoring, while the center’s career services department offers employment opportunities.

Students

Student enrollment was 396 in 2007-2008 (686 full-time equivalent).

About 80% of the freshmen class in 2008-2009 was male and women were 20% of the class.

Undergrads are 100% of enrolled students.

Students living in the US make up 100% of incoming freshmen.
